Zoning and Its Impact on Townhouse Barrie
Zoning regulations in Barrie are designed to ensure the orderly development of the city while preserving its unique character. These regulations can significantly impact the value and potential uses of a townhouse. For instance, some areas are zoned for single-family homes only, while others allow for multi-family dwellings such as townhouses and apartments. Resale Potential of Townhouses in Barrie
When buying a townhouse in Barrie, it's important to consider its resale potential. Factors such as location, size, condition, and the presence of desirable features can significantly affect a townhouse's resale value. For instance, townhouses located in desirable neighbourhoods or near amenities such as schools, parks, and shopping centres tend to have higher resale values. Additionally, newer townhouses or those in excellent condition are more likely to attract potential buyers. Lifestyle Appeal of Townhouses in Barrie
One of the main reasons why townhouses in Barrie are so popular is their lifestyle appeal. These properties offer a comfortable and convenient lifestyle, with many located close to the city centre and offering easy access to public transportation, shopping, dining, and recreational facilities. Moreover, townhouses often come with shared amenities such as swimming pools, gyms, and playgrounds, adding to their appeal. Seasonal Market Trends in Barrie
Like any real estate market, the townhouse market in Barrie is subject to seasonal trends. Typically, the market is most active in the spring and fall, with a slowdown during the summer and winter months. However, these trends can vary from year to year and can be influenced by factors such as economic conditions, interest rates, and housing supply and demand.
